Measurement of the B-+/- production cross-section in pp collisions at root s=7 and 13 TeV

The production of B +/- mesons is studied in pp collisions at centre-of-mass energies of 7 and 13 TeV, using B-+/- -> J/psi K-+/- decays and data samples corresponding to 1.0 fb(-1) and 0.3 fb(-1), respectively. The production cross-sections summed over both charges and integrated over the transverse momentum range 0 < pT < 40 GeV/c and the rapidity range 2.0 < y < 4.5 are measured to be sigma-(pp -> B-+/- X, root s = 7 TeV) = 43.0 +/- 0.2 +/- 2.5 +/- 1.7 mu b, sigma(pp -> B-+/- X, root s = 13 TeV) = 86.6 +/- 0.5 +/- 5.4 +/- 3.4 mu b, where the first uncertainties are statistical, the second are systematic, and the third are due to the limited knowledge of the B-+/- -> J/psi K-+/- branching fraction. The ratio of the cross-section at 13 TeV to that at 7 TeV is determined to be 2.02 +/- 0.02 (stat) +/- 0.12 (syst). Differential cross-sections are also reported as functions of pi, and y. All results are in agreement with theoretical calculations based on the state-of-art fixed next-to-leading order quantum chromodynamics.
